Summary: Get rid of the NGROUPS hard limit.

This patch removes all fixed-size arrays which depend on NGROUPS, and
replaces them with struct group_info, which is refcounted, and holds an
array of pages in which to store groups.  groups_alloc() and groups_free()
are used to allocate and free struct group_info, and set_group_info is used
to actually put a group_info into a task.  Groups are sorted and b-searched
for efficiency.  Because groups are stored in a 2-D array, the GRP_AT()
macro was added to allow simple 1-D style indexing.

This patch touches all the compat code in the 64-bit architectures.
These files have a LOT of duplicated code from uid16.c.  I did not try to
reduce duplicated code, and instead followed suit.  A proper cleanup of
those architectures code-bases would be fun.  Any sysconf() which used to
return NGROUPS now returns INT_MAX - there is no hard limit.

This patch also touches nfsd by imposing a limit on the number of groups in
an svc_cred struct.

This patch modifies /proc/pid/status to only display the first 32 groups.

This patch removes the NGROUPS define from all architectures as well as
NGROUPS_MAX.

This patch changes the security API to check a struct group_info, rather
than an array of gid_t.

This patch totally horks Intermezzo.

This was built and tested against 2.6.0-test6 (BK today) on an i386.

@@ -328,6 +328,32 @@
 struct io_context;			/* See blkdev.h */
 void exit_io_context(void);
 
+#define NGROUPS_SMALL		32
+#define NGROUPS_BLOCK		((int)(EXEC_PAGESIZE / sizeof(gid_t)))
+struct group_info {
+	int ngroups;
+	atomic_t usage;
+	gid_t small_block[NGROUPS_SMALL];
+	int nblocks;
+	gid_t *blocks[0];
+};
+
+#define get_group_info(info) do { \
+	atomic_inc(&(info)->usage); \
+} while (0);
+
+#define put_group_info(info) do { \
+	if (atomic_dec_and_test(&(info)->usage)) \
+		groups_free(info); \
+} while (0)
+
+struct group_info *groups_alloc(int gidsetsize);
+void groups_free(struct group_info *info);
+int set_current_groups(struct group_info *info);
+/* access the groups "array" with this macro */
+#define GRP_AT(gi, i) ((gi)->blocks[(i)/NGROUPS_BLOCK][(i)%NGROUPS_BLOCK])
+
+

@@ -1072,9 +1072,160 @@
 /*
  * Supplementary group IDs
  */
-asmlinkage long sys_getgroups(int gidsetsize, gid_t __user *grouplist)
+
+/* init to 2 - one for init_task, one to ensure it is never freed */
+struct group_info init_groups = { .usage = ATOMIC_INIT(2) };
+
+struct group_info *groups_alloc(int gidsetsize)
+{
+	struct group_info *info;
+	int nblocks;
+
+	nblocks = (gidsetsize/NGROUPS_BLOCK) + (gidsetsize%NGROUPS_BLOCK?1:0);
+	info = kmalloc(sizeof(*info) + nblocks*sizeof(gid_t *), GFP_USER);
+	if (!info)
+		return NULL;
+	info->ngroups = gidsetsize;
+	info->nblocks = nblocks;
+	atomic_set(&info->usage, 1);
+
+	if (gidsetsize <= NGROUPS_SMALL) {
+		info->blocks[0] = info->small_block;
+	} else {
+		int i;
+		for (i = 0; i < nblocks; i++) {
+			gid_t *b;
+			b = (void *)__get_free_page(GFP_USER);
+			if (!b) {
+				int j;
+				for (j = 0; j < i; j++)
+					free_page((unsigned long)info->blocks[j]);
+				kfree(info);
+				return NULL;
+			}
+			info->blocks[i] = b;
+		}
+	}
+	return info;
+}
+
+void groups_free(struct group_info *info)
 {
+	if (info->ngroups > NGROUPS_SMALL) {
+		int i;
+		for (i = 0; i < info->nblocks; i++)
+			free_page((unsigned long)info->blocks[i]);
+	}
+	kfree(info);
+}
+
+/* export the group_info to a user-space array */
+static int groups_to_user(gid_t *grouplist, struct group_info __user *info)
+{
+	int i;
+	int count = info->ngroups;
+
+	for (i = 0; i < info->nblocks; i++) {
+		int cp_count = min(NGROUPS_BLOCK, count);
+		int off = i * NGROUPS_BLOCK;
+		int len = cp_count * sizeof(*grouplist);
+
+		if (copy_to_user(grouplist+off, info->blocks[i], len))
+			return -EFAULT;
+
+		count -= cp_count;
+	}
+	return 0;
+}
+
+/* fill a group_info from a user-space array - it must be allocated already */
+static int groups_from_user(struct group_info *info, gid_t __user *grouplist)
+ {
 	int i;
+	int count = info->ngroups;
+
+	for (i = 0; i < info->nblocks; i++) {
+		int cp_count = min(NGROUPS_BLOCK, count);
+		int off = i * NGROUPS_BLOCK;
+		int len = cp_count * sizeof(*grouplist);
+
+		if (copy_from_user(info->blocks[i], grouplist+off, len))
+			return -EFAULT;
+
+		count -= cp_count;
+	}
+	return 0;
+}
+
+/* a simple shell-metzner sort */
+static void groups_sort(struct group_info *info)
+{
+	int base, max, stride;
+	int gidsetsize = info->ngroups;
+
+	for (stride = 1; stride < gidsetsize; stride = 3 * stride + 1)
+		; /* nothing */
+	stride /= 3;
+
+	while (stride) {
+		max = gidsetsize - stride;
+		for (base = 0; base < max; base++) {
+			int left = base;
+			gid_t tmp = GRP_AT(info, base + stride);
+			while (left >= 0 && tmp < GRP_AT(info, left)) {
+				GRP_AT(info, left) = GRP_AT(info, left+stride);
+				left -= stride;
+			}
+			GRP_AT(info, left + stride) = tmp;
+		}
+		stride /= 3;
+	}
+}
+
+/* a simple bsearch */
+static int groups_search(struct group_info *info, gid_t grp)
+{
+	int left, right;
+
+	if (!info)
+		return 0;
+
+	left = 0;
+	right = info->ngroups;
+	while (left < right) {
+		int mid = (left+right)/2;
+		int cmp = grp - GRP_AT(info, mid);
+		if (cmp > 0)
+			left = mid + 1;
+		else if (cmp < 0)
+			right = mid;
+		else
+			return 1;
+	}
+	return 0;
+}
+
+/* validate and set current->group_info */
+int set_current_groups(struct group_info *info)
+{
+	int retval;
+	struct group_info *old_info;
+
+	retval = security_task_setgroups(info);
+	if (retval)
+		return retval;
+
+	groups_sort(info);
+	old_info = current->group_info;
+	current->group_info = info;
+	put_group_info(old_info);
+
+	return 0;
+}
+
